Woman charged after injured baby found outside home

A woman has been charged after a newborn baby was found seriously injured outside a Dandenong North home.

The boy was discovered outside the address about 2.40am on August 30.

The newborn was initially taken to hospital in a critical condition.

Police on Thursday said the baby remained in hospital with “serious but non-life-threatening injuries”.

A 25-year-old woman was taken from the scene, on Gladstone Road, to hospital under police guard.

She remains in hospital and has since been charged with conduct endangering life and recklessly cause injury.

She has been released on bail and will appear before Dandenong Magistrates Court on 5 December.
